sale executive, technical sales
Dovico Software Inc · Virtual job based in Moncton, NB · 20% commission per sale
applies via timesheet.dovico.com
Verdict
Dovico Software Inc. is a legitimate, established software company (founded 1993, Moncton-based) with a fully functional website, active careers page, and strong business verification. The posting is detailed with specific NOC classification, clear responsibilities, and realistic requirements. However, the compensation structure (20% commission only, no base salary mentioned) and the virtual role designation create minor concerns typical of sales positions, though not indicative of fraud.
- Commission-only compensation structure+12
Salary listed as '20% commission per sale' with no base salary mentioned; while legitimate for sales roles, commission-only structures are sometimes used in fraudulent postings to obscure vague pay
- Virtual role designation+8
Position explicitly marked 'Virtual job based in Moncton, NB'; virtual roles are common in legitimate tech companies but also appear in some fraudulent postings
- Professional application channels-5
Applicants directed to apply via company email (info@dovico.com) and official careers portal (timesheet.dovico.com/careers); no residential/PO box/virtual office address requested
- Active careers page-8
web.hasJobsListing='yes'; company maintains active careers page at dovico.com/careers, indicating ongoing legitimate hiring
- Location match-10
web.locationMatch='match'; posting claims virtual role based in Moncton, NB, which matches company's actual headquarters location (91 John St, Moncton, NB E1C 2H3)
- Detailed job description and requirements-10
Posting includes specific NOC code, detailed task list, education requirements, screening questions, and 5+ years experience requirement—all hallmarks of legitimate job postings
- Business name and website match-15
web.businessMatch='match' with high confidence (0.95); official website dovico.com is reachable and verified as legitimate software company founded 1993
Application flags (0)
No application flags detected.
Employer checks
{
"web": {
"websiteUrl": "https://dovico.com/",
"websiteReachable": "yes",
"businessMatch": "match",
"locationMatch": "match",
"hasJobsListing": "yes",
"applicationAddressType": "none",
"confidence": 0.95,
"summary": "Dovico Software Inc. is a legitimate, established software company founded in 1993 and based in Moncton, NB (91 John St, Moncton, NB E1C 2H3). Official website is fully functional. Company specializes in project time tracking and team collaboration software. Has active careers page at dovico.com/careers. Posting claims virtual role based in Moncton, NB—matches company location. No mailing address provided in posting (applicants apply online/email), so applicationAddressType is \"none\"."
}
}Full description
Occupation (NOC): Technical sales specialists - wholesale trade (62100) Location: Virtual job based in Moncton, NB Salary: 20% commission per sale Hours: Full-time Term: Permanent Workplace: [object Object] Education: Other trades certificate or diploma, Sales and marketing operations/marketing and distribution teacher education, or equivalent experience Work site environment: Business Work setting: Business services Tasks: Prepare sales or other contracts, Identify and solicit potential clients, Assess client's needs and resources to recommend the appropriate goods or services, Use sales forecasting software, Conduct sales transactions through Internet-based electronic commerce, Consult with clients after sale to provide ongoing support, Review and adapt information regarding product innovations, competitors and market conditions Supervision: No supervision responsibility Sales experience: Software Security and safety: Reference required Work conditions and physical capabilities: Attention to detail, Sitting Own tools/equipment: Internet access Personal suitability: Client focus, Excellent oral communication, Excellent written communication, Organized, Reliability, Team player, Initiative, Creativity, Positive attitude Screening questions: Do you have experience working in this field?, Do you have the required certifications listed in the job posting?, Do you meet the language requirements listed in the job posting for the position (English or French)? Experience: 5 years or more How to apply: By email: info@dovico.com Online: https://timesheet.dovico.com/careers